Basic training on Biosimilar Development:
Sr.No Topic Time
1. Basics of Biosimilar/Biologics/Biogenerics 2.5 Hrs
2. General Introduction of Commercialized Biosimilar-
Peptide,Proteins,Mabs- Indian and Global view
3.5 Hours
3. Clone development for Biosimilar/Biologics/Mabs 3.5 Hours
4. General introduction of host - Prokaryotic/Eukaryotic and
Cell culture for Biosimilars/Biologics
3.5 Hours
5. Upstream Biology of Biosimilar/Biologics 5 Hours
6. Downstream Biology of Biosimilars/Biologics 5 Hours
7. Bioanalytical Techniques for Biosimilars/Biologics 5 Hours
8. Stability and Formulation of Biosimilars / Biologics 5 Hours
Advanced Training on Biosimilar Development:
Sr.No Topic Time
1. Basics of Biosimilar/Biologics/Biogenerics 2.5 Hrs
2. General Introduction of Commercialized Biosimilar-
Peptide,Proteins,Mabs- Indian and Global view
3.5 Hours
3. Clone development for Biosimilar/Biologics/Mabs 3.5 Hours
4. General introduction of host - Prokaryotic/Eukaryotic and
Cell culture for Biosimilars/Biologics
3.5 Hours
5. Upstream Biology of Biosimilar/Biologics 5 Hours
6. Downstream Biology of Biosimilars/Biologics 5 Hours
7. Bioanalytical Techniques for Biosimilars/Biologics 5 Hours
8. Stability and Formulation of Biosimilars / Biologics 5 Hours
9 CMC Approach for Biosimilar/Biologics development 5 Hours
10 PAT,DOE Approach for Biosimilar development 5 Hpurs
11 Case study on recombinant proteins(Biosimilars)
development
5 Hours
12 Case study on Mabs 5 Hours
13 Complete process for GCSF development 5 Hours
14 Complete process for Rituximab Development 5 Hours
15 Column chromatography for purification of Biosimilars 5 Hours
16 Cell lines used in biosimilar development 5 Hours
17 Regulatory filling for Biosimilars 5 Hours
18 Fermentors- Operation 5 Hours
19 Akta Purification System- Operation 5 Hours
20 Bioanalytical techniques-SDS
PAGE,NATIVE,WESTERN,ELISA,LCMS,GCMS,RP-
HPLC,CZE,ETC
7.5 Hours
